Agartala, August 9: The Pradesh Congress celebrated the Movement Apart from India today in front of the Pradesh Congress Bhavan with due dignity. Then on this day, the party leadership offered wreaths at the Gandhi Ghat Shaheed Bedi.

Moreover, on this day tributes are paid to the portraits of Netaji Subhas Chandra Bose, Mahatma Gandhi.

On this day, Pradesh Congress President Ashish Kumar Saha said, on the eve of independence, Mahatma Gandhi called for the Quit India movement. And at that time the people of the country jumped to release the grief of subjugation of the country. According to him, although the country is independent, the current ruling party is again pushing the country towards subjugation and claimed that the freedom of speech and self-respect of the countrymen are being disturbed in various ways due to the current government.
